Abstract

An electronic device is provided. The electronic device includes a light source module, a display module including at least one layer, a camera module, and a processor operatively connected to the light source module, the display module, and the camera module. The processor may emit light through the light source module along a waveguide formed in the at least one layer of the display module, may use the camera module to detect, based on at least one pattern structure formed in the waveguide, at least a part of the light, which has been reflected from a user's eyeball, and may track the movement of the user's eyeball, based on the detected light.
